PM Sharif Affirms Pakistan’s Role in Global Peace Efforts

Islamabad: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if has reaffirmed Pakistan’s commitment to facilitating the peaceful resolution of global issues, following the successful conclusion of the First High-Level Committee Meeting under the Islamabad Memorandum of Understanding in Bürgenstock, Switzerland. The discussions reportedly advanced positively, setting a roadmap toward a final agreement within 60 days.

According to Radio Pakistan, the meeting, attended by representatives from the United States and Iran, resulted in the establishment of a High-Level Committee to ensure political oversight and the initiation of further technical discussions. Prime Minister Sharif acknowledged the leadership of both the United States and Iran for their dedication to constructive dialogue and expressed gratitude to Qatar for its pivotal role in fostering the necessary conditions for the negotiations.

The Prime Minister also extended thanks to the Swiss Government for hosting the talks and paid tribute to Field Marshal Asim Munir for his significant contributions to the success of the discussions. Additional acknowledgments were directed toward Deputy Prime Minister Ishaq Dar and Interior Minister Mohsin Naqvi for their diplomatic and logistical efforts throughout the process.

In his statement, Prime Minister Sharif reiterated Pakistan’s resolve to continue its active role in promoting dialogue and diplomacy as a means to achieve peaceful and lasting solutions to global challenges.
